Find the slope: numbers are: (1,-3) and (-5,-4)

[tex]\frac{-3 - (-4)}{1 - (-5)}[/tex]

= [tex]\frac{-3 + 4}{1 + 5}[/tex]

= 1/6

Answer: the slope is 1/6
